Chili is a hearty and flavorful dish that is perfect for a cold winter day. It is also very easy to make in the Ninja Foodi, a multi-cooker that can pressure cook, air fry, and slow cook. In this article, we will show you how to make a delicious chili in the Ninja Foodi in just 30 minutes.

Ingredients

  • 1 pound ground beef
  • 1 onion, chopped
  • 2 cloves garlic, minced
  • 2 cups crushed tomatoes
  • 1 cup water
  • 1 teaspoon chili powder
  • 1 teaspoon ground cumin
  • 1/2 teaspoon smoked paprika
  • 1/4 teaspoon salt
  • 1/4 teaspoon black pepper
  • 1 (15 ounce) can kidney beans, rinsed and drained
  • 1 (15 ounce) can black beans, rinsed and drained
  • 1 (15 ounce) can corn, drained
  • 1/2 cup chopped fresh cilantro

Instructions

1. Heat the Ninja Foodi to the Saute setting.
2. Add the ground beef and cook until browned.
3. Add the onion and garlic and cook until softened.
4. Add the crushed tomatoes, water, chili powder, cumin, smoked paprika, salt, and pepper.
5. Stir to combine.
6. Close the lid and set the pressure cook setting to high for 20 minutes.
7. Allow the pressure to release naturally for 10 minutes, then release any remaining pressure manually.
8. Open the lid and stir in the kidney beans, black beans, corn, and cilantro.
9. Serve immediately.

How Long To Pressure Cook Chili In Ninja Foodi?

The Ninja Foodi is a multi-cooker that can pressure cook, air fry, bake, roast, and dehydrate. It’s a great appliance for making chili, as it can cook the chili quickly and evenly.

To pressure cook chili in the Ninja Foodi, you will need:

  • 1 pound of ground beef
  • 1 onion, chopped
  • 2 cloves of garlic, minced
  • 2 bell peppers, chopped
  • 1 (15 ounce) can of black beans, rinsed and drained
  • 1 (15 ounce) can of kidney beans, rinsed and drained
  • 1 (15 ounce) can of corn, drained
  • 1 (10 ounce) can of diced tomatoes with green chilies, undrained
  • 1 tablespoon of chili powder
  • 1 teaspoon of ground cumin
  • 1 teaspoon of dried oregano
  • 1/2 teaspoon of salt
  • 1/4 teaspoon of black pepper
  • 1 cup of beef broth

Instructions:

1. Heat the olive oil in the Ninja Foodi on the Saute setting.
2. Add the ground beef and cook until browned.
3. Add the onion, garlic, and bell peppers and cook until softened.
4. Stir in the black beans, kidney beans, corn, tomatoes, chili powder, cumin, oregano, salt, and pepper.
5. Add the beef broth and stir to combine.
6. Lock the lid and set the pressure cooker to cook on high pressure for 20 minutes.
7. Allow the pressure to release naturally for 10 minutes, then carefully release any remaining pressure.
8. Serve the chili with your favorite toppings, such as shredded cheese, sour cream, and guacamole.

The total cooking time for this recipe is about 30 minutes, including the time to brown the beef and the time to cook the chili under pressure.

This recipe makes about 6 servings of chili.

How long do I pressure cook chili in a Ninja Foodi?

The cooking time for chili in a Ninja Foodi will vary depending on the ingredients and desired consistency. For a basic chili recipe, cook the chili on high pressure for 20 minutes, then let it naturally release pressure for 10 minutes. For a thicker chili, cook the chili on high pressure for 30 minutes, then let it naturally release pressure for 10 minutes.
